
Red Sox expect Walker Buehler to return from IL to face Mets
May 14, 2025; New York City, New York, USA; New York Mets starting pitcher Clay Holmes (35) pitches against the Pittsburgh Pirates during the first inning at Citi Field. Mandatory Credit: Brad Penner-Imagn Images If you blink, you might miss Jarren Duran making his impact on a game. A night after sparking a 3-1, series-opening…